Blue Bird Corporation , a renowned leader in the production of electric and low-emission school buses, has taken a significant step towards community empowerment and environmental sustainability by donating an advanced electric school bus to Hoop Bus Inc. This 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ization is committed to fostering youth programming and community engagement throughout North America. The donation marks a pivotal moment in the ongoing efforts to combine environmental consciousness with impactful community outreach.

The full-size, zero-emission electric school bus is not just an ordinary vehicle; it has been transformed into a dynamic, interactive mobile basketball court. Equipped with basketball hoops mounted at both the front and rear, the bus serves as a symbol of innovation and community spirit. Hoop Bus plans to utilize this cutting-edge vehicle to reach thousands of at-risk youth in under-resourced communities across California, offering them not only a chance to engage in physical activities but also to benefit from mentorship and educational programs.

The official debut of the zero-emission Hoop Bus is scheduled for today at 1:00 p.m. PST at West Oakland Middle School in Oakland, California. The dedication ceremony will be followed by one of Hoop Bus’ signature programs, the P.E. Takeover. This high-energy, inclusive event focuses on social-emotional learning, targeting students from grades 4 through 12. The program aims to promote health equity, encourage team-building activities, and foster self-love among participants. This P.E. Takeover also serves as the kickoff event for Hoop Bus’ series leading up to the NBA All-Star weekend scheduled for February 14-16, 2025.

Since its establishment in 2019, Hoop Bus has made a remarkable impact, reaching approximately 320,000 youth annually through hundreds of events nationwide. The organization gained notable recognition when it was featured in the NBA’s Emmy Award-winning 75th Anniversary campaign. Operating six “vehicles of change” in major metropolitan areas such as San Francisco, Los Angeles, New York, and Miami, Hoop Bus continues to expand its reach and influence. Impressively, three of these mobile basketball courts are converted Blue Bird buses, demonstrating the strong partnership between the two organizations.

The transformation of the vehicle into a state-of-the-art mobile basketball court involved extensive modifications. Hoop Bus incorporated collaborative seating areas, ample storage spaces, flatscreen TVs, and a dedicated basketball rack to enhance the interior. Additionally, the nonprofit organization installed solar panels on the bus, which will generate clean energy to power the sound and entertainment systems. The specific model donated by Blue Bird is the Blue Bird All American electric bus, known for its reliability and efficiency. This 40-foot vehicle is traditionally capable of transporting up to 84 students and can cover a distance of up to 120 miles on a single charge. Its impressive range and capacity make it an ideal choice for Hoop Bus’ mobile outreach programs, ensuring that the organization can reach diverse communities without compromising on performance or sustainability.

In addition to the bus donation, Blue Bird’s partner organization, InCharge Energy, has significantly contributed to the initiative. As a leading provider of EV charging solutions and service support for electric fleets, InCharge Energy donated a Level 2 AC vehicle charger to Hoop Bus. This charger ensures that the electric bus can be fully charged overnight, ready to deliver basketball-based programming to local youth each day. The donation package includes a virtual site assessment, route planning consultation, the necessary charging hardware, and one year of InControl charge management and maintenance software, along with a comprehensive data plan.

Blue Bird Corporation stands out as the only U.S.-owned and operated school bus manufacturer in the country. The company has established itself as a proven leader in the production of low- and zero-emission school buses, with more than 2,500 electric-powered buses currently in operation.
